Python库hermes_python-0.1.26针对ARM架构优化

版权申诉
0 下载量 154 浏览量 更新于2024-10-10 收藏 2.59MB ZIP 举报
资源摘要信息:"hermes_python-0.1.26-cp27-cp27mu-linux_armv6l.whl 是一个 Python 包,它通过 PyPI 官网提供的资源进行下载。该包是针对特定平台的 wheel 文件,具体来说是为 Python 2.7 版本、在 ARMv6 架构的 Linux 系统上使用的多版本兼容的 Python 解释器 (cp27mu 表示 multi-use) 打包的。下载后解压,该资源可以被安装并用于开发或运维工作。" 知识点详细说明如下: 1. PyPI 官网 - PyPI 是 Python Package Index 的缩写,它是 Python 的官方软件仓库。 - 在 PyPI 上,开发者可以上传他们的 Python 包,其他用户可以下载使用。 - PyPI 网站提供了一个搜索和查找各种 Python 包的平台,这些包可能包括库、工具或框架。 2. hermes_python 包 - hermes_python 是一个在 PyPI 上的特定包,版本号为 0.1.26。 - 根据包的名称,可以推断该包可能是与 Hermes 相关的 Python 实现或工具,Hermes 通常指的是消息传递或中间件的一部分。 - 包的具体功能和用途需要查看其官方文档或源代码才能得知。 3. wheel 文件格式 - wheel 文件是一个 Python 分发格式,它在 2012 年被引入,旨在简化安装过程。 - wheel 是一种预编译的包格式,可以加速安装过程,因为它们避免了编译源代码的需要。 - wheel 文件具有一定的平台兼容性,以确保它们可以在特定的系统和 Python 版本上运行。 4. cp27-cp27mu 标识 - cp27 表示该 wheel 文件兼容 Python 版本 2.7。 - cp27mu 表示它也是为 multi-use Python 编译的,即它兼容 CPython 2.7 和多个实现(如 PyPy),且是用于未优化的(即不包含二进制扩展模块)构建。 5. linux_armv6l 平台 - linux_armv6l 表明这个 wheel 文件是为运行在 ARMv6 架构上的 Linux 系统设计的。 - ARMv6 是一种较旧的 32 位 ARM 架构,通常用于嵌入式设备。 - 这意味着开发者可以在具有该 CPU 架构的设备上使用这个包,例如某些树莓派模型。 6. 开发语言 Python - Python 是一种广泛使用的高级编程语言,因其易读性和简洁的语法而受到开发者的青睐。 - Python 支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。 - Python 有丰富的标准库和第三方库,因此它可以应用于各种编程领域,如 Web 开发、数据科学、机器学习、网络服务器、自动化和更多。 7. 后端开发与运维 - 后端开发通常指的是构建和维护 Web 应用程序的服务器端逻辑、数据库和架构。 - 运维(运维工程师)通常负责确保应用和服务的稳定运行,这涉及到部署、监控、故障排除和性能优化。 - 该包可能包含有助于这些任务的工具或库,例如可以通过 hermes_python 管理消息队列或实现特定的后端服务功能。 通过上述知识点的详细说明,可以得出结论:下载的 hermes_python-0.1.26-cp27-cp27mu-linux_armv6l.whl 包可能是一个为特定版本的 Python 和基于 ARMv6 的 Linux 系统设计的工具或库,适用于后端开发和运维任务。在安装和使用之前,需要查看包的官方文档以了解其确切用途和使用方法。